ENGINEER DESIGN TEST OF HOWITZER, LIGHT, SELF PROPELLED, 105-MM, XM104
Abstract
The XM104 self-propelled howitzer, pilot No. 3, was tested to determine the readiness of the weapon system for engineering and user tests. The automotive program consisted of amphibious operations and 4000 miles of endurance testing. Amphibious capabilities are limited by low draw bar pull and by maneuverability which is influenced by wind effects on the canvas enclosure; carbon monoxide concentrations are also a potential hazard. Track life is unsatisfactory and component service life and maintenance are adversely influenced by vehicle vibration. It is recommended that the vehicle undergo engineering and user tests after the appropriate modifications are made in the problem areas revealed during this test.
